Прошу помощи в создании ПБ для драйвера шагового мотора

Использование драйверов двигателей и пользовательских блоков к ним
Ответить
Аватара пользователя
nickoass
Рядовой
Сообщения: 42
Зарегистрирован: 26.02.2017{, 20:13}
Репутация: 2
Откуда: Киров

Прошу помощи в создании ПБ для драйвера шагового мотора

#1

Сообщение nickoass » 27.02.2017{, 23:18}

Есть ли у кого готовый пользовательский блок для драйвера шагового мотора (Step / Dir) на основе библиотеки AccelStepper? Или кто сможет создать данный блок ?
Тема с шаговиками очень популярна, а в Flprog имеется только функциональный блок, который управляет непосредственно шаговиком, а управление драйвером нет.
ссылка на библиотеку http://www.airspayce.com/mikem/arduino/ ... index.html
описание на русском http://hobbytech.com.ua/arduino....вигател
Вложения
AccelStepper-ma.zip
(62.04 КБ) 82 скачивания

Аватара пользователя
Anydy
Администратор
Сообщения: 3286
Зарегистрирован: 30.12.2017{, 12:10}
Репутация: 279
Имя: Андрей

Прошу помощи в создании ПБ для драйвера шагового мотора

#2

Сообщение Anydy » 28.02.2017{, 10:18}

Вот например из примера Random.
Что конкретно то нужно? У библиотеки функционал то не маленький...
Вложения
AcStRnd-CODE-.ubi
(799.47 КБ) 104 скачивания

Аватара пользователя
nickoass
Рядовой
Сообщения: 42
Зарегистрирован: 26.02.2017{, 20:13}
Репутация: 2
Откуда: Киров

Прошу помощи в создании ПБ для драйвера шагового мотора

#3

Сообщение nickoass » 28.02.2017{, 21:15}

Если изъясняться точно, то заявленная мной библиотека, не совсем отвечает моей задаче.
Мне нужен пользовательский блок со следующими параметрами...
1. Булевый вход разрешения запуска шагового мотора
2. Вход с заданием переменной для задания количества шагов, на которые должен          отработать шаговый мотор.
3. Булевый вход с заданием направления вращения.
4. Два булевых выхода с сигналами Step и Dir

Можно упростить задачу, не закладывать в блок вход с заданием переменной для задания количества шагов, могу на выходе блока по сигналу Step поставить счетчик и считать и задавать в нем нужное количество шагов для вращения мотора.
Вот както так 

Аватара пользователя
Anydy
Администратор
Сообщения: 3286
Зарегистрирован: 30.12.2017{, 12:10}
Репутация: 279
Имя: Андрей

Прошу помощи в создании ПБ для драйвера шагового мотора

#4

Сообщение Anydy » 01.03.2017{, 00:27}

Попробуйте какой нибудь скетч из примеров к библиотеке...какой подойдет на основе его и будем делать блок!

Ответить

Вернуться в «Управление двигателями»